SOURCE: can not start at a slow speed with foot pedal

THE FOOT PEDLE IS NOTHING BUT A REASTAT. A REASTAT IS A WIRE WRAPPED AROUND A CONDUCTOR THE WINDINGS START OUT FAR APART AND GET CLOSER TOGETHER THE FARTHER YOU PUSH THE PEDLE DOWN . THE FAR APART WIRES ARE THE SLOW SPEED THE CLOSER ONES ARE FASTER SPEED
THESE WIRES WILL WEAR OUT OVER TIME OR CORRODE OVER TIME AND CAUSE THIS PROBLEM. TRY SOME ELECTRICAL CONTACT CLEANER AND SPRAY THE FOOT PEDLE INSIDE ANY WHERE YOU CAN AND LET DRY. MOST CONTACT CLEANERS ARE NONE CONDUCTIVE AND DRY IN MINUTES

My Memory Craft 8000wil not adjust the speed. It works for 8 seconds and then just stops. It only goes faster on the high speed setting and then just stops. It will only go two speeds slow and fast.

I believe this machine can operate without the foot pedal attached. Disconnect the foot pedal and try using Start/Stop button. If same symptoms with pedal detached then likely problem is speed control module inside machine.

No matter how hard I press down on the foot pedal my needle speed is super slow. The needle position indicator sometimes shows up when the needle is down and the needle continues it slow speed even when my...

is the machine easy to turn by handwheel? if not it may be seizing and needs servicing.

if the machine is free to turn by hand it sounds like your foot control is in need of repair or replacement - see a tech.
